    Ap1—0 to 10 centimeters (0.0 to 3.9 inches); 30 percent very pale brown (10YR 7/3) and 70 percent brown (10YR 5/3), 30 percent pale brown (10YR 6/3) and 70 percent dark brown (10YR 3/3), moist; sandy loam; moderate fine granular structure; soft, very friable, nonsticky, nonplastic; 5.5 very fine and fine roots throughout; 5.5 very fine and fine interstitial pores; fragments; slightly alkaline, pH 7.4, hellige-truog; clear smooth boundary. Lab sample # 87P02688; moist when described;. the soil material with (10YR 7/3 dry; 10YR 6/3 moist) is coarse and very coarse pumice sand from Mt. Mazama; many very fine and fine roots throughout
    Ap2—10 to 25 centimeters (3.9 to 9.8 inches); 30 percent very pale brown (10YR 7/3) and 70 percent brown (10YR 5/3), 30 percent pale brown (10YR 6/3) and 70 percent dark brown (10YR 3/3), moist; sandy loam; weak fine granular structure; soft, very friable, nonsticky, nonplastic; 0.5 very fine roots throughout; 5.5 very fine and fine interstitial pores; fragments; neutral, pH 7.2, hellige-truog; clear wavy boundary. Lab sample # 87P02689; moist when described;. the soil material with (10YR 7/3 dry, 10YR 6/3 moist) is coarse and very coarse pumice sand from Mt. Mazama; few very fine roots throughout
    Bw—25 to 46 centimeters (9.8 to 18.1 inches); 30 percent very pale brown (10YR 7/3) and 70 percent brown (10YR 5/3), 30 percent pale brown (10YR 6/3) and 70 percent dark brown (10YR 3/3), moist; sandy loam; weak fine and medium subangular blocky structure; soft, very friable, nonsticky, nonplastic; 0.5 very fine roots throughout; 5.5 very fine and fine interstitial pores; 5 percent by volume 2-39-75 millimeter igneous, unspecified fragments and 5 percent by volume 75-162-250 millimeter igneous, unspecified fragments; neutral, pH 7.2, hellige-truog; clear wavy boundary. Lab sample # 87P02690; moist when described;. the soil material with (10YR 7/3 dry, 10YR 6/3) moist is coarse and very coarse pumice sand from Mt. Mazama; few very fine roots throughout
    Bq—46 to 53 centimeters (18.1 to 20.9 inches); 30 percent very pale brown (10YR 7/3) and 70 percent pale brown (10YR 6/3), 30 percent pale brown (10YR 6/3) and 70 percent brown (10YR 4/3), moist; sandy loam; moderate medium subangular blocky structure; hard, firm by silica, nonsticky, nonplastic; brittle; 0.5 very fine roots throughout; 2.5 fine vesicular and 2.5 fine interstitial pores; 5 percent by volume 2-39-75 millimeter igneous, unspecified fragments and 5 percent by volume 75-162-250 millimeter igneous, unspecified fragments; neutral, pH 7.2, hellige-truog; clear wavy boundary. Lab sample # 87P02691; moist when described;. the soil material with (10YR 7/3 dry, 10YR 6/3 moist) is coarse and very coarse pumice sand from Mt. Mazama; few very fine roots throughout
    2R—53 to 61 centimeters (20.9 to 24.0 inches); fragments. Lab sample # 87P02692
